Florida has filed a lawsuit against Target, claiming the company misled investors by promoting diversity, equity and inclusion initiatives<\/strong><\/p>\n The US state of Florida has sued supermarket giant Target, accusing it of misleading investors and causing financial losses by promoting diversity, equity and inclusion (DEI) initiatives.<\/p>\n Attorney General James Uthmeier filed the lawsuit in federal court in Fort Myers on Thursday, claiming that Target failed to disclose the potential financial risks associated with its DEI policies, thereby misleading investors.<\/p>\n The lawsuit also alleges that Target\u2019s DEI efforts, including its 2023 Pride Month campaign, contributed to consumer backlash and boycotts. It claims that this reaction led to a decline in the company\u2019s stock value and a loss of more than $25 billion in market capitalization.<\/p>\n \u201cCorporations that push radical leftist ideology at the expense of financial returns jeopardize the retirement security of Florida\u2019s first responders and teachers,\u201d<\/em> Uthmeier said. He stressed that his office will pursue corporate reform so that \u201ccompanies get back to the business of doing business \u2013 not offensive political theatre.\u201d<\/em><\/p>\n
